Noseforthenet Posted July 30, 2019 Share Posted July 30, 2019 (edited) 1 hour ago, mll said: Callahan will be on IR all season with a degenerative back condition and his contract is likely insured. Condon was 3M in salary. Tampa signed McElhinney in free agency to a 2-year deal and already had Domingue as back-up. Condon is probably heading to the AHL (- they've traded Connor Ingram earlier in the summer) and will have a residual cap hit of 1.325M on Tampa's books. Given how close they are to the cap they probably felt it was better to move Callahan and take the hit for Condon then use LTIR - from earlier this summer: I think we have a winner! There's no way the Sens do that trade if he wasn't insured.
